如果我有一个排序列表(比如快速排序),如果我要添加很多值,最好暂停排序,将它们添加到最后,然后排序,或者使用二进制文件来正确放置项目添加它们.如果这些项目是随机的,或者已经或多或少的顺序,它会有所不同吗?
可能重复:
按字母顺序排序列表
如何按字母顺序存储输入,我将名称输入到arraylist中:
persons.add(person);
Run Code Online (Sandbox Code Playgroud)
怎么做?
我有一个对象数组,每个对象都有一个给定的名字和一个姓氏.使用getGivenName和getSurname方法将这些名称写入对象.
我需要按姓氏的字母顺序对数组中的元素进行排序.我怎样才能做到这一点?